首页
/ AntiMicroX跨平台手柄映射工具完全指南:低延迟配置与多场景应用

AntiMicroX跨平台手柄映射工具完全指南:低延迟配置与多场景应用

2026-05-01 09:36:13作者:平淮齐Percy

还在为喜欢的游戏不支持手柄而烦恼?想在Linux系统上用手柄玩游戏却找不到合适的工具?AntiMicroX作为一款跨平台手柄映射神器,不仅支持Windows和Linux双系统,还能实现低延迟按键响应和智能配置管理,让任何PC游戏都能完美适配手柄。本文将通过"痛点诊断-解决方案-场景落地-高手进阶"四个维度,带你全面掌握这款工具的使用技巧。

一、痛点诊断:手柄映射常见问题的"症状-病因-处方"分析

1. 症状:手柄连接后无反应

病因:权限配置不当或驱动兼容性问题
处方:Linux用户需将当前用户添加到input组,执行命令sudo usermod -aG input $USER后重启系统。Windows用户建议使用USB 2.0接口,部分老旧手柄在USB 3.0接口下可能存在兼容性问题。

2. 症状:按键映射延迟明显

病因:使用了低效的模拟输入方式或系统资源占用过高
处方:在设置中切换至uinput或XTest事件处理模式,关闭后台不必要的程序。实测表明,采用uinput模式可将延迟控制在8ms以内,比普通模拟方式快3倍以上。

3. 症状:摇杆控制精度差,存在漂移

病因:未进行摇杆校准或死区设置不当
处方:通过校准功能重新设置摇杆中心和范围,建议将死区值设置为5%-10%(约2000-4000)。校准后可使摇杆控制精度提升40%,有效解决漂移问题。

4. 症状:换游戏需重新配置按键

病因:缺乏配置文件管理和自动切换机制
处方:利用AntiMicroX的自动配置功能,为不同游戏创建独立配置文件,并设置窗口标题自动匹配规则。配置文件默认保存在~/.local/share/antimicrox/profiles(Linux)或C:\Users\用户名\AppData\Local\antimicrox\profiles(Windows)。

二、解决方案:3大技术突破与2种安装流派对比

1. 三大核心技术突破

(1)双引擎输入处理系统

AntiMicroX采用uinput和XTest双引擎架构,其中uinput模式直接与内核交互,适合需要低延迟的动作游戏;XTest模式兼容性更广,适合办公和休闲游戏。两种模式可在设置中一键切换,满足不同场景需求。

(2)智能配置管理系统

通过窗口标题识别技术,实现游戏启动时自动加载对应配置。系统内置100+游戏配置模板,涵盖FPS、MOBA、竞速等多种类型,用户也可创建自定义模板并分享到社区。

(3)多设备协同控制

支持同时连接4个以上手柄,每个手柄可独立配置映射方案。配合"独立控制"选项,可实现多人游戏时的设备隔离,避免按键冲突。

2. 两种安装流派对比

(1)稳定流派:包管理器安装

Windows:从官网下载最新安装包(3.1以上版本),安装时勾选"添加到系统PATH"选项。
Linux:推荐使用Flatpak安装,命令如下:

flatpak install flathub io.github.antimicrox.antimicrox
flatpak run io.github.antimicrox.antimicrox

优势:自动处理依赖关系,更新方便;缺点:可能不是最新版本。

(2)前沿流派:源码编译安装

git clone https://gitcode.com/GitHub_Trending/an/antimicrox
cd antimicrox
cmake .
make
sudo make install

优势:可获取最新功能;缺点:需手动解决依赖,适合高级用户。

成功校验点:启动程序后,在顶部下拉菜单能看到已连接的手柄名称,说明安装成功。

AntiMicroX深色主题界面,展示手柄按键映射配置 深色主题界面适合夜间使用,可减少眼部疲劳,界面布局清晰展示了摇杆、D-pad和按键的映射关系

三、场景落地:单人/双人/家庭三种使用模式配置

1. 单人模式:沉浸式游戏体验

核心配置:将右摇杆映射为鼠标,肩键映射为左右键,实现精准瞄准。
步骤

  1. 在主界面选择手柄,点击"Quick Set"进入快速设置
  2. 选择"FPS模板",自动配置基础按键映射
  3. 进入"校准"界面,完成摇杆中心和范围设置
  4. 测试并微调摇杆灵敏度,建议初始值设为50%

手柄校准界面,解决摇杆跑偏问题 校准界面通过可视化图表帮助用户设置摇杆死区和范围,提高控制精度

成功校验点:移动摇杆时,鼠标光标应平滑移动,无明显延迟或跳帧。

2. 双人模式:本地多人游戏

配置要点

  1. 连接两个手柄,在主界面点击"Add"添加第二个设备
  2. 为每个手柄创建独立配置文件,如"Player1"和"Player2"
  3. 在"Options"中勾选"独立控制"选项
  4. 测试按键映射,确保两个手柄操作无冲突

设备要求:建议使用带独立供电的USB hub,避免因供电不足导致手柄失灵。

3. 家庭模式:多人共享配置

实现方案

  1. 创建家庭共享配置文件夹,设置权限为所有用户可读写
  2. 为不同家庭成员创建个性化配置文件
  3. 使用"配置导入/导出"功能,实现配置快速切换
  4. 开启"自动保存"功能,避免配置丢失

推荐设备:Xbox Wireless Controller或DualShock 4,兼容性最佳。

四、高手进阶:故障排除与配置迁移全攻略

1. 故障排除决策树

手柄未被识别

  • 检查USB连接 → 更换接口 → 重启电脑 → 重新安装驱动

按键映射无效

  • 检查配置文件是否加载 → 测试其他配置 → 检查事件处理模式 → 重启程序

摇杆漂移

  • 重新校准 → 清洁摇杆电位器 → 调整死区设置 → 硬件故障需更换

控制器底层映射配置界面,用于故障诊断 控制器映射界面可查看底层按键映射关系,帮助诊断硬件识别问题

2. 配置迁移指南

手动迁移

  1. 找到配置文件目录(Linux: ~/.local/share/antimicrox/profiles,Windows: C:\Users\用户名\AppData\Local\antimicrox\profiles
  2. 复制所有.amgp文件到新设备对应目录
  3. 在新设备上启动AntiMicroX,加载迁移的配置文件

云同步方案

  1. 将配置文件夹链接到云同步目录(如Dropbox、OneDrive)
  2. 创建同步脚本:
# Linux示例
ln -s ~/Dropbox/antimicrox_profiles ~/.local/share/antimicrox/profiles
  1. 在所有设备上设置相同的同步链接

3. 高级功能:宏命令与脚本

AntiMicroX的高级模式支持宏命令录制和定时执行,适合复杂操作自动化:

  1. 点击"Advanced"按钮打开高级设置
  2. 在"Turbo"标签页启用Turbo功能,设置按键间隔(建议30-50ms)
  3. 录制连招:按顺序点击技能按键,设置延迟时间
  4. 保存为宏配置,在游戏中一键触发

高级功能配置界面,展示宏命令设置 高级功能界面支持宏命令录制、按键组合和定时执行,提升游戏操作效率

4. 设备兼容性矩阵

手柄类型 兼容性 推荐指数 注意事项
Xbox Wireless Controller ★★★★★ 完美支持所有功能 需要Xbox无线适配器
DualShock 4 ★★★★☆ 支持振动和触控板 需安装额外驱动
Switch Pro Controller ★★★★☆ 基本功能支持 部分高级功能受限
第三方手柄 ★★★☆☆ 视芯片而定 建议选择带Xbox布局的型号

5. 延迟测试方法论

测试工具:使用USB示波器或延迟测试软件(如"Input Lag Tester")
测试步骤

  1. 将手柄按键连接到测试设备
  2. 启动AntiMicroX并配置按键映射
  3. 记录按键按下到屏幕响应的时间
  4. 重复测试10次,取平均值

优化建议:关闭系统动画、降低图形设置、使用有线连接,可进一步减少延迟。

结语

AntiMicroX通过强大的跨平台支持、低延迟技术和灵活的配置管理,为手柄玩家提供了一站式解决方案。无论是单人沉浸式游戏、双人对战还是家庭共享,都能通过简单配置实现专业级手柄体验。随着游戏手柄的普及,这款工具将成为PC游戏玩家的必备利器。

记住,最好的配置方案需要不断调整优化。建议从基础设置开始,根据个人习惯和游戏类型逐步微调,打造属于自己的完美手柄映射方案。

AntiMicroX关于对话框,显示程序版本信息 About对话框显示程序版本和依赖信息,建议定期更新以获取最新功能和bug修复

登录后查看全文
热门项目推荐
相关项目推荐

项目优选

收起
docsdocs
暂无描述
Dockerfile
703
4.51 K
pytorchpytorch
Ascend Extension for PyTorch
Python
567
693
atomcodeatomcode
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get Started
Rust
548
98
ops-mathops-math
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
957
955
kernelkernel
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
411
338
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.6 K
940
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.08 K
566
AscendNPU-IRAscendNPU-IR
AscendNPU-IR是基于MLIR(Multi-Level Intermediate Representation)构建的,面向昇腾亲和算子编译时使用的中间表示,提供昇腾完备表达能力,通过编译优化提升昇腾AI处理器计算效率,支持通过生态框架使能昇腾AI处理器与深度调优
C++
128
210
flutter_flutterflutter_flutter
暂无简介
Dart
948
235
Oohos_react_native
React Native鸿蒙化仓库
C++
340
387